Megan Thee Stallion [1] has new music on the way, and fans can't hardly wait for it. On April 17, the Houston hottie graced the stage during the first weekend of Coachella [2] and debuted a brief snippet of one of her new tracks described as a very motherf*cking personal" song, bluntly dedicated it "to whom it may the f*ck concern."
"Dear f*ck n***a, still can't believe I used to f*ck wit' ya / poppin' Plan B's 'cause I ain't planned to be stuck wit' ya," she raps on the song, reportedly titled "Letter to My Ex." "Ladies, love yourself, 'cause this sh*t could get ugly / That's why it's, 'F*ck n***as, get money!'" Fans in the crowd and on social media went nuts over the gritty track, which samples Jodeci and Wu-Tang Clan's "Freak'n You Remix."
Following her Coachella performance, Megan shared a video of her rapping the song during her Sunday set via Instagram [4] captioned, "I performed a snippet of my unreleased song at Coachella last night 🔥🔥🔥 I see y'all saying y'all want it … maybe I should just gone headdd release this #hottiechella."
On April 18, she posted another video on Twitter [5] of her rapping along to the official audio in a car with friends, which almost instantly went viral online. When a fan tweeted the rapper [6] asking her to drop the new song, Megan responded with one word: "Friday." [7]
In an interview with POPSUGAR [8], Megan previously teased that she's been "working hard in the studio" and had some new songs ready to debut at her festival appearances — clearly, she kept her word! Now that we have an official release date for her new track, the countdown is on.
